Kessler had three one-man shows at the San Francisco Museum of Modern Art. His work was also exhibited at U.C. Berkeley, U.C. Davis, The University of Indiana, The Oakland Museum, Gottham Bookmart Gallery in New York City, Light Sound Dimension in San Francisco, and the Focus Gallery in San Francisco.
Kessler's photography is represented in the Theatre Arts Collection of the New York Public Library, in the Erotica Collection of the Kinsly Institute, and in numerous private collections.
Chester Kessler died in San Francisco on May 6, 1979.
